Abstract

This proposal presents a game design-centered study focused on engineering an intrinsically integrated educational video game for teaching x86 assembly through interactive visual metaphors. The research examines whether embedding low-level programming content as core gameplay mechanics can enhance comprehension while preserving game enjoyment and intrinsic motivation. The study will deliver a prototype, Assembly Architect, iteratively refined using the Rapid Iterative Testing and Evaluation (RITE) method and empirically evaluated with engineering students. Key evaluation metrics include (1) learning outcomes, (2) intrinsic motivation, and (3) player experience. The expected contribution of this research is an empirically evaluated approach for designing intrinsically integrated educational games targeting technical domains, supported by design principles derived from iterative development and evidence on the role of interactive visual metaphors in understanding complex programming constraints. This work advances the field of game engineering by emphasizing design innovation as a driver of educational technology.
